What if this next season of life could be your most vibrant, energized, and joy-filled yet? I’m sharing exactly what I’m doing in this season of late perimenopause/early menopause to support my body, my mind, and my spirit—and answering some of your most-asked questions along the way. We’re talking about everything from hormone therapy to supplements, sleep, muscle building, emotional resilience, and how to reframe aging as the most magical chapter of your life. (Yes, really!) If you’re navigating changes in your body, feeling unsure about what’s “normal,” or just want to feel vibrant and strong again, this episode is for you. In this episode, we cover: ✨ Why your mindset is just as important as your supplements ✨ What I’ve learned (and changed) about bioidentical hormones ✨ My current routine—including progesterone, testosterone, and more ✨ The surprising way mindset can actually make you look younger ✨ My go-to supplements: DHEA, pregnenolone, magnesium, D3, omega-3s, probiotics, and more ✨ Why building muscle is one of the most powerful things you can do in midlife ✨ Practical tips for sleep, sex drive, and staying emotionally regulated ✨ Your listener Qs answered—from oils to workouts to when to start estrogen! 💬 Friend, your body is so wise.
